A major crash on the North Freeway caused significant delays for drivers in the area on Friday afternoon. According to the Houston Police Department, the incident occurred at 2:42 PM at the 10298 North Freeway Outbound location.
The crash was reported as a "CRASH/MAJOR/FSRA" incident, indicating a significant collision that is expected to result in a full freeway shutdown. Motorists should anticipate extended delays in the area as authorities work to clear the scene.
This is a developing story. Additional details about potential injuries or lane closures have not yet been provided.
